About the Author

Annabel Karmel is the mother of three children and the UK’s leading expert on feeding children. She works with leading US parenting websites such as Parents.com and has appeared on many TV shows, including the Today show and The View. Check out her popular app, Annabel’s Essential Guide to Feeding Your Baby & Toddler, and visit her website, AnnabelKarmel.com, to learn more.

The layout can be a little frustrating when your just looking for a list of recipes to try out for your little one which is why I gave this 4 stars.If you don't know what are age appropriate foods though, this is a good book. The foods are simple and easy to make and there is a pretty good variety of foods for your little one to try out.

So I stuck with the more basic recipes in this but still found this immensely helpful. I knew nothing about "stewing" fruit, and I had no idea that you could puree meat in a blender. This book includes tips on how to peel, mash and/or cook fruits, what you can introduce at what age, what items freeze well, and a little bit on nutritional contents. It gives you ideas on what foods make a tasty combo in the blender. I never tried my creations (I didn't want my daughter seeing me make a face if I didn't like it). However, my daughter liked every single creation I made from the book. Using this recipe book gave me confidence with trying some of my own concoctions and helped me stay on track with exposing my youngster to a variety of foods early on. There is an index in the back-- one of my favorite features. I used this the most during the 6 to 10 month phase. I also recommend having two of Annabel Karmel's silicone baby food freezer trays-- or something similar. I froze food in the trays and then popped the cubes of frozen food into quart-size or gallon-size ziplock bags and labeld and dated them. I own a blender, nothing fancing, and that worked fine.

This is one of two baby cookbooks that I own, but this is by far the best. The recipes are organized by age group, but even more helpful is an index in the back for recipes that use a specific ingredient. I've used this numerous times when I've forgotten to pull food out of the freezer and need to make my son food based on the ingredients I have. There's also a section based solely on no-cook purees!The book also contains lots of useful information on things like weaning and food allergies. As a first-time mother I found all of the information extremely helpful. Once you start moving up in stages it also recommends how many servings of starches, vegetables, etc. your baby should be consuming.The recipes themselves are easy to follow with specific instructions for everything ranging from peeling tomatoes to making your own vegetable and chicken stock. Each recipe also comes with an estimated cooking time, whether or not it is suitable for freezing and the number of portions the recipe will make.I also taste everything before I feed it to my son and so far, it's all been very good!

Before purchasing this book I actually checked out several of the top reviewed baby puree recipe books from the library so I could decide which one was the best fit for my needs. I liked this one because the recipes were simple and nicely split by age suitability. Plus the pictures were nice. I give it four stars because it would be nice to have a sample menu by age like I saw in at least one book and I find that since I am making these in bulk and freezing, it's easier to just make say peas and sweat potatoes separately and then giving him one of each (I freeze them in ice-cube tray sized portions) for a meal instead of making a recipe containing peas and sweet potatoes mixed together. That said, I've made several of the recipes and so far my son seems to enjoy them. It's also expanded my horizons. If not for the book I know I wouldn't have made rutabaga that's for sure!

If anyone is on the fence about making vs. buying their baby food... DEFINITELY make it yourself. I didn't buy any of the fancy baby food systems, I use a veggie steamer and food processor that I already own and it works exactly the same. It is soooo much cheaper than the processed stuff on the shelf filled with preservatives, and I use organic food!This is a great beginners book for baby purees. Easy recipes, food/nutrition facts, and feeding guidelines by age (though my pediatrician is a little conservative compared to this book as to when to introduce berries).The ONLY reason this did not get 5 stars is I was somewhat surprised (and disappointed) the author did not include spices that mix well with the veggies. My baby loves cumin and nutmeg and cinnamon with her veggies, and I thought this book would include at least some suggestions for what spices could be used.But other than that, it is a really great book and I would recommend buying.
